Role: Compliance Assistant (12-month FTC), Liverpool.

What is the purpose of the role?

To assist the IW&I business in meeting its Anti Money Laundering regulatory obligations when opening certain new client accounts and when carrying out periodic reviews of its existing clients.,

  • To assist the Account Opening team with on-boarding enquiries in relation to the Investec Wealth & Investment business, in addition to assisting with the processing of periodic reviews of existing clients.

  • The Compliance Assistant will be responsible for the following activities in relation to the Account Opening Team within the Compliance Department:

  • Work as part of the Account Opening team to review requests for new accounts in line with the firm's policies and procedures and regulatory requirements to ensure that clients are on boarded in a timely manner.

  • Process screening requests for PEPs/. Sanctions and negative media as part of the onboarding and periodic review process.

  • The assistant will be required to follow through any reasonable enquiries to ensure that we do not facilitate any activities relating to financial crime.

  • This may include report writing and working with the wider AML/financial crime monitoring programme and would include the monitoring of existing accounts and the review of exception reports.

  • Maintain a professional relationship with both the business and external parties.

  • Carry out any investigation and liaise with the relevant parties to ensure remediation of any issues identified.
